Output 6b38a234e84260adc6b63df5df8034016bf18d5cca1cfa2b2dfc8ddb2fc8e2fe:28

value
58653
script pubkey
OP_0 OP_PUSHBYTES_20 9f568e3c6245b8052523c5fcee982dc233dc910e
address
bc1qnatgu0rzgkuq2ffrch7waxpdcgeaeygw3s9r87
transaction
6b38a234e84260adc6b63df5df8034016bf18d5cca1cfa2b2dfc8ddb2fc8e2fe
spent
true